I purchased 10 new GX270s with the intention of joining them to my domain over VPN via a Cisco 1711 router. The tunnel is always active in the router.

None of the 270s will join the domain. I receive one of two errors after it asks for a username and password of a person authorized to join the domain.

"The semaphore timeout period has expired"

"The domain CBHS is currently unavailable"

We currently have a Dell Latitude D600 at this location and it joins the domain without a hitch over the same connection.

Two of the 270s are using wireless cards and the other 8 are using the built in Intel gigabit ethernet cards. Whether I use the NIC or the Wireless card they still timeout and will not join.

Things I have tried to reolve the issue.

Obtained latest drivers for the NIC and Chipset.

Disabled the onboard NIC in the BIOS and used a 3rd party NIC.

Updated the BIOS to revision A04

Compared all services running on the D600 and matched them with running services on the 270s.

Confirmed all TCP/IP settings match between the D600 and the 270s.

Has anyone else experienced odd behavior with the GX270 and any network related issues? I experienced some odd behavior with some GX270s and Powerquest Drive Image about 6 months ago. The NIC would intermitantly not initialize with the Drive Image Boot Disks.
